Whether you’re heading to college, coming back home, or trying out a summer abroad program, your mind is probably occupied with what seems like an endless to-do list.  Well, you can cross off transporting and storing your belongings.  Moving can be overwhelming enough without lugging around everything you own.  With Collegeboxes, you can pack any items you’d like to be transported or stored, and have them picked up from your residence or school.  From there, they can either be stored for an extended period of time or shipped to the location of your next endeavor.  Below is what you should know about utilizing Collegeboxes to ensure a smooth move:

Summer Storage

If you’re planning on going home for the summer or taking time to study abroad, be sure to utilize summer storage. Your belongings will be waiting safely for you when you get back, after just a few steps:

  1. After creating an account online if you have ordered a supply kit, it will be shipped to your campus mail room. (Order early: Shipping typically takes 3-5 business days!)
  2. On your selected pickup date a Collegeboxes representative will come to your door to pick up your items.
  3. They will then be stored at a local U-haul facility until the date you have selected for campus delivery.
  4. On your selected delivery date a Collegeboxes representative will come to your school to drop off your items (your delivery address can be added to your account at any time over the summer).

Ship to School

Moving from home to college means there is already plenty on your plate, so let us take care of your boxes.  These steps explain how you can leave your baggage at the door–literally — with the ship to school option.

  1. After creating an account online if you have ordered a supply kit it will be shipped to your home.
  2. On your selected pickup date Fedex will pick up your items from your home.
  3.  They will be shipped to a U-Haul location near your school where they will be stored until the date you have selected for delivery.
  4. On your selected delivery date a Collegeboxes representative will come to your campus to drop off your items. (Your delivery address can be added to your account at any time over the summer)

International Shipping

Planning on traveling a considerable distance for your next adventure?  No worries.

  1. After creating an account online if you have ordered a supply kit it will be shipped to your home or campus mail room.
  2. On your selected pickup date Fedex Express will pick up your items from your home or your campus mail room.
  3. Your items will be shipped anywhere across the globe.

In addition to these services Collegeboxes accommodates any length of storage for students who may be returning to campus early or even studying abroad for a year. Your account online allows you to manage and edit your pickups, deliveries and storage time frame as well as view live tracking information for your items.
